Essential Traffic Rules and Regulations

Speed Limits

Rwanda maintains strict speed limits that vary by road type and location. Urban areas typically have speed limits of 40 km/h, while highways allow speeds up to 80 km/h. Some main roads between cities permit speeds of 60 km/h. These limits are rigorously enforced, making it crucial to understand them before you rent a car in Kigali.

Seatbelt Requirements

All occupants in a vehicle must wear seatbelts at all times. This regulation applies to both front and rear passengers. Failure to comply results in immediate fines and potential vehicle impoundment. Mobile Phone Usage

Using handheld mobile devices while driving is strictly prohibited. Drivers caught using phones face substantial fines and potential license suspension. Licensing Requirements

International Driving Permits

Foreign visitors can drive in Rwanda using their valid international driving permit alongside their home country license. The question "Do I need an international driving permit to drive in Rwanda" is common among tourists, and the answer is yes for extended stays. Short-term visitors may use their home license for up to 90 days.

Police Checkpoints

Regular police checkpoints operate throughout Rwanda, particularly on major highways and city entrances. Officers check licenses, vehicle documentation, and sobriety. Safety Equipment

Vehicles must carry emergency triangles, first aid kits, and fire extinguishers. Many rental companies provide these items as standard equipment. Safety gear for your rental car in Rwanda includes reflective vests and emergency contact information.

Traffic Signals and Signs

Rwanda uses international traffic sign standards with occasional Kinyarwanda text. Traffic lights follow standard red-yellow-green sequences. Roundabouts are common and require yielding to traffic already in the circle.

Emergency Procedures

Accident Protocols

In case of accidents, drivers must immediately contact police and remain at the scene. What to do in case of a breakdown includes contacting rental company emergency services and local authorities.

Emergency Contacts

Key emergency numbers include 112 for general emergencies and 113 for police. Rental companies provide 24-hour emergency assistance. Essential car safety tips for long drives include keeping emergency contacts readily available.
